    Abstract: A mobile phone (mobile electronic device) includes an acceleration sensor that detects an acceleration, a communication module that performs communication, and a controller. When the number of steps based on the acceleration detected by the acceleration sensor has reached a first step count during an ON-state of the communication function of the communication module, the mobile phone shifts from a stop state to a walking state. The controller maintains the ON-state of the communication function of the communication module when the mobile phone shifts from the stop state to the walking state. The controller turns OFF the communication function of the communication module when the number of steps based on the acceleration has reached a second step count larger than the first step count.

    Abstract: Provided is a portable electronic device that has a pedometer function wherein generation of counting errors has been suppressed. The portable electronic device is provided with a housing, an acceleration-detecting unit that is mounted in the housing, a counting unit that counts the number of steps based on temporal changes in acceleration detected by the acceleration-detecting unit, and a correcting unit that corrects the number of steps counted by the counting unit.
